The GDS370x supports 4 SIP accounts and 4 lines, this section covers the configuration of basic and advanced SIP settings for
each SIP account.

Configures the IP address or the domain name of the outbound proxy, media gateway, or session border
controller. It's used by the GDS for firewall or NAT penetration in different network environments.
If a symmetric NAT is detected, STUN will not work and only an outbound proxy can provide a solution.

Configures the backup outbound proxy to be used when the “Outbound Proxy” registration fails. By default, this
field is left empty.
